Rocket Systems Launch Program (RSLP) Innovative Delivery of Effects (RIDE) Supplemental Request for Information (RFI) – Industry Statements of Capability (SOCs)
Solicitation # RIDE2026
The Space Systems Command's Rocket Systems Launch Program is implementing the Innovative Delivery of Effects acquisition strategy to provide responsive space, experimental, and research, development, test and evaluation launch services for the Department of War and other government agencies. This strategy succeeds the OSP-4, SRP-O, and SRP-4 programs and aims to support a wide range of missions, from low Earth orbit payloads to suborbital vehicle development. The government is contemplating the use of two multiple-award indefinite-delivery indefinite-quantity contract vehicles. One IDIQ will focus on commercial Space Transportation Services using fixed-price structures, while the second will address non-commercial Space-Related Activity launch services, which may involve complex research and development and utilize hybrid cost-reimbursement and fixed-price task orders. The current supplemental request for information seeks statements of capability from industry to refine acquisition requirements and determine commerciality. Interested companies must provide details on their flight heritage, launch vehicle production processes, and their ability to meet mission assurance requirements. The government is specifically looking for feedback on streamlining mission assurance practices and identifying high-value deliverables for minimum award guarantees to avoid duplicating previous acquisitions. Potential contractors for the non-commercial IDIQ must demonstrate the ability to perform cost-reimbursement contracts, including maintaining approved accounting systems. An industry day is scheduled for September 22 through 23, 2026, at Kirtland Air Force Base, with statements of capability due by October 2, 2026.

The National Aeronautics and Space Administration’s Goddard Space Flight Center is soliciting proposals for the acquisition of the Landsat 10 Spacecraft under RFP 80GSFC26R0015, which supersedes the previous draft issued in May 2026. The contract seeks a spacecraft capable of delivering multi-spectral imagery across visible to shortwave-infrared and thermal infrared bands to support long-term monitoring of Earth’s land surfaces and coastal regions, with a mission objective to operate continuously for at least five years. The spacecraft will be placed in a 653-kilometer sun-synchronous low-Earth orbit and equipped with the Landsat Instrument Suite, providing 26 spectral bands with a ground sampling distance between 10 and 60 meters and a 164-kilometer swath width. NASA will provide the space and launch services segments, while USGS will manage the ground system and mission operations. The contractor is required to deliver detailed analytical models, including 3D CAD, thermal, structural, dynamic, and attitude control subsystem models, as well as comply with stringent environmental standards covering radiation, space charging, magnetics, atomic oxygen, and micrometeoroid/orbital debris exposure, with microcircuit requirements aligned to MIL-STD-883. Key deliverables include the spacecraft and related models to be submitted to the Landsat 10 Project Office, alongside adherence to interface requirements defined in multiple attachments for spacecraft-to-ground, payload-to-launch, and space environmental systems. The response deadline has been extended to August 31, 2026, at 1:00 p.m. EST, and the solicitation includes updated documentation such as the Spacecraft Contractor Standards, a revised Master Equipment List, and a DPAS rating of DO-C9 on the SF-1449 form. Government-furnished equipment, including flight umbilical connectors, launch services support, and propellant, must be coordinated with schedule milestones ranging from L-18 months to L-1 month, with payload processing facilities provided by the government from L-60 days through L+7 days. No cost or pricing data, evaluation factors, or contract value estimates are specified in the release.

Laser Interferometer Space Antenna (LISA) Frequency Reference System (FRS) Flight
Solicitation # NASA-GSFC-LISA-FRS-FLIGHT
NASA Goddard Space Flight Center is seeking the design, fabrication, qualification, and delivery of flight Frequency Reference System (FRS) hardware for the Laser Interferometer Space Antenna (LISA) mission. The requirement consists of three flight models and one flight spare, each comprising an optical reference cavity (FRS-O) and frequency-locking electronics (FRS-E). These subsystems utilize the Pound-Drever-Hall technique to achieve the picometer-scale measurement stability required for the mission. Due to the aggressive delivery schedule and the need for specific flight heritage and supplier relationships, NASA intends to issue a sole source contract to BAE Systems Space and Mission Systems Inc. The project follows a strict delivery timeline with flight units scheduled for delivery between February 9, 2029, and March 11, 2030, with the flight spare due by May 31, 2030. The contractor is responsible for the full lifecycle of the hardware, including integration, testing, and minimal post-delivery support. Key technical requirements include adherence to ISO 7 cleanliness standards for the FRS-O, compliance with the LISA Contamination Control Plan, and the execution of Comprehensive Performance Tests and TVAC environmental testing. The contract structure includes cost-reimbursement for non-recurring engineering, firm-fixed-price for production, and time-and-materials for special study task orders.
